Biffing
noun, verb, slang
noun, verb, slang ·Uncommon ·College level
Definitions
Noun
- 1 A hitting or punching. informal
"And amidst the biffings and beatings and bleedings, Chuckie, who only defended the Man because he was famous, began to see an absurdity in this hatred, in this fear."
Verb
- 1 present participle and gerund of biff form-of, gerund, participle, present
